1926.102 A01
- Issued
- Nov 8, 2019
- Abate by
- Nov 29, 2019
- Penalty
- Initial $3,410 · Current $3,410
General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1926.102(a)(1): The employer did not ensure that each affected employee used appropriate eye or face protection when exposed to eye or face hazards from flying particles, molten metal, liquid chemicals, acids or caustic liquids, chemical gases or vapors, or potentially injurious light radiation. Employees were exposed to struck-by hazards. Employees engaged in roofing activities with the use of pneumatic nail guns were exposed to eye injuries. Employees were not provided with eye protection.
